the forest brightens
and i stumble out onto
a grassy plain

a breeze gusts,
and a moment later
leaves lazily fall

evergreens
sprout through leaf litter -
scale model forest


the perfect tree
sits on a flat boulder -
roots clawing rock;
stunted and deformed,
but very much alive

mountains in autumn -
all color has blanched,
but for red berries


the foothills seen
through flame-colored leaves
look painted
